Visual experience is not necessary for the development of face-selectivity in the lateral fusiform gyrus

© 2020 National Academy of Sciences. All rights reserved. The fusiform face area responds selectively to faces and is causally involved in face perception. How does face-selectivity in the fusiform arise in development, and why does it develop so systematically in the same location across individual...
